10:00-11:30 am Morning Session
Topic: Best Practices in Planned Giving - A Roundtable Approach
Using a roundtable discussion approach, we will offer best practice pointers on various planned giving topics. Topic examples are “working with professional advisors,” “administering a CGA program,” “securing real estate gifts,” “using storytelling in your work with donors,” “planned giving and capital campaigns,” and several others. Each discussion will be facilitated by a practitioner or advisor who knows the topic well. You will have time to participate in several topic discussions during the session.
12:30-1:30 pm Afternoon Session
Topic: Giving in Chicago – Findings From a First-ever Study of Local Philanthropy
Speakers: Terry Mazany, President & CEO, Chicago Community Trust, and Dr. Una Osili, Director of Research, Indiana University Lilly School of Philanthropy
Terry and Una will present findings from a first-ever comprehensive study on charitable giving in the Chicago area. Commissioned as part of the Chicago Community Trust’s centennial celebration, this unique study offers insights into Chicago’s individual, corporate and foundation giving patterns and the metro area’s philanthropic environment. This session may be of interest to planned giving and other development professionals, as well as to local nonprofit CEO’s/executive directors and advisors who specialize in charitable planning.
